摘要
The thermodynamic potential for fixed charges in dielectric continua is given for arbitrary values of the polarization density. Minimization of the functional gives the equilibrium polarization density (equivalently image charges) and the electrostatic potential throughout the media. The functional, which in general involves volume integrals, for the case of piecewise uniform dielectrica is reduced to surface integrals of the constrained surface charge density at the dielectric discontinuities. A linear integral equation for the induced surface charge, which can be solved by iteration, is given. The conjugate thermodynamic force for the constrained surface charge is also given. The latter formulation is suitable for Car-Parrinello or Lagrangian molecular dynamics in complex geometries. (C) 2003 American Institute of Physics.
